In a small bowl, combine the granulated sugar and orange zest. Gently press the zest into the sugar with the back of a spoon to release the oils and create a fragrant orange sugar mixture.
Pour the fresh orange juice into a large pitcher or mixing bowl.
Add the orange sugar mixture to the orange juice and stir until the sugar is completely dissolved.
Slowly pour in the sparkling water while gently stirring to retain the carbonation.
Fill serving glasses with ice cubes and carefully pour the orange soda over the ice.
Optional: Garnish each glass with a fresh mint leaf for an added touch of freshness.
Serve immediately and enjoy your zesty, bubbly homemade orange soda!
